How do you dynamically name an object in Java?

How do you name an object dynamically in Java?

The closest you will get in Java is: Map<String, String[]> map = new HashMap<String, String[]>(); for (int k=0; k=5; k++){ map. put(Integer. toString(k), new String[3]); } // now map.

How do you dynamically name a variable in Java?

There are no dynamic variables in Java. Java variables have to be declared in the source code1. Depending on what you are trying to achieve, you should use an array, a List or a Map ; e.g. It is possible to use reflection to dynamically refer to variables that have been declared in the source code.

How do you change an object name in Java?

You can rename an object in a context by using Context. rename(). This example renames the object that was bound to “cn=Scott Seligman” to “cn=Scott S”. After verifying that the object got renamed, the program renames it to its original name (“cn=Scott Seligman”), as follows.

INTERESTING:  Why Java is a technology?

How do I add dynamic attributes in POJO class?

Just create a hashmap in the class and add as many values as you want, dynamically.

  1. public Map<String, Object> attributes = new HashMap<>();
  2. //create an object of this class anywhere, and access/modify the map.

What is an anonymous object Java?

Anonymous object. Anonymous simply means nameless. An object which has no reference is known as an anonymous object. It can be used at the time of object creation only. If you have to use an object only once, an anonymous object is a good approach.

How do you change a variable name in Java?

Highlight and right click on the variable you want to rename. Navigate to Refactor and select Rename…. Type in your new variable name and press Enter. Verify that occurrences of the variable are updating as you type.

How do you dynamically initialize a member variable of a class in Java?

Dynamic initialization can be achieved using constructors and passing parameters values to the constructors. This type of initialization is required to initialize the class variables during run time.

What is dynamic variable in Java?

The variables that are initialized at run time is called as dynamic variable. The type of a dynamic variable is resolved at run-time (The variables that are initialized at run time). … A static variable has its memory reserved at compilation time.

What is a dynamic variable?

In programming, a dynamic variable is a variable whose address is determined when the program is run. In contrast, a static variable has memory reserved for it at compilation time.

INTERESTING:  Quick Answer: Can I get a job by only learning Python?

How do I rename a file in eclipse?

To rename the project, simply right-click the project and select “Refactor/Rename…”. Fill in the new name and click OK.

How do I rename a method in eclipse?

2.1. Renaming Variables and Methods

  1. Select the element.
  2. Right-click the element.
  3. Click the Refactor > Rename option.

How do I change all references in eclipse?

If you are on windows/ubuntu platform use alt+shift+R or on mac use command+option+r . It will refactor all the occurences where that variable is used.

How do I create a class dynamic property in Java?

This class inherits the HashTable class.

Creating a . properties file

  1. Instantiate the Properties class.
  2. Populate the created Properties object using the put() method.
  3. Instantiate the FileOutputStream class by passing the path to store the file, as a parameter.

Can we create dynamic class in Java?

Dynamic Class creation enables you to create a Java class on the fly at runtime, from source code created from a string. Dynamic class creation can be used in extremely low latency applications to improve performance.

How do you read POJO class values?

To access the objects from the POJO class, follow the below steps: Create a POJO class objects. Set the values using the set() method. Get the values using the get() method.

MainClass. java:

  1. //Using POJO class objects in MainClass Java program.
  2. package Jtp. …
  3. public class MainClass {
  4. public static void main(String[] args) {
Categories PHP